  G24 / heaven

Last week saw the launch of G24, a free online pdf newspaper from the Guardian Group, which the audience is expected to print out in order to read and is readily available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.

This seems to straddle the middle ground between the whole new media versus old media / death of the print debate with its up to date information in a format we feel comfortable taking to the toilet.

Except it doesn’t do the job as well as either print or online media.

Firstly, online print is two steps more accessible than G24 in that as soon as it comes on screen, you can read it, and it is easier to scan the pages for relevant stories. Secondly, online news offers moving images and optional access to a wealth of related information to the subject.

With regards to traditional print media, G24 requires you to access a computer and print out the newspaper. In an impatient - or lazy - world this can be time consuming especially when the newspaper with more stories only costs 70p and you can pick it up on the way to work.
